What is the ideal waist size for a man?
What should your waist measurement be? For men, a waist circumference below 94cm (37in) is ‘low risk’, 94–102cm (37-40in) is ‘high risk’ and more than 102cm (40in) is ‘very high’. For women, below 80cm (31.5in) is low risk, 80–88cm (31.5-34.6in) is high risk and more than 88cm (34.6in) is very high.

What size waist should a 5’5 man have?
Ashwell has proposed that governments adopt a simple public health message: “Keep your waist to less than half your height.” That means someone who is 5 foot 5 (65 inches; 167.64 centimeters) should maintain a waistline smaller than 33 inches or 84 centimeters.

How do you measure waist correctly?
The correct place to measure your waist is halfway between your lowest rib and the top of your hipbone. This is roughly in line with your belly button. Breathe out normally and measure. Make sure the tape is snug, without squeezing the skin.
Does waist or inseam measurement come first in men’s pants sizes?
Men’s pants sizes come in a combination of 2 numbers, first the waist size number, then the inseam size number. The waist size refers to the circumference of the pants waistband and usually for men spans from 28″ – 40″+ inches.
